On Halloween beginning at 1pm, central TNN will air a Friday the 13th marathon featuring parts 2-7. What happened to 1 I wonder?
Also on Saturday American Movie Classics wil air Halloween 2-5 as well as the new one hour Backstory on the making of the first film at 10am, central. These movies as well as the documentary will be repeated numerous times next week. The first Halloween will air on F/X October 27 at 5pm, central. |

Halloween 4 and 5 kinda made you like him more though. He was always that dark, deep-voiced hero in the first two, but I think that the writing may have given the character some light humor towards horror film buffs for 4 and 5. I recall references towards other horror films there. And then there was #6 for which he was wasted in a 5-minute scene. Sadly the reason was that Donald died after filming that scene, and the script had to be rewritten. The result was a boring and uninetionally funny mess.

It's a VERY tough one to explain...but I'll tell u as simple as possible:
The man in black was the leader of a group that was associated with the druids...who had been haunting Michael for years and years driving him to kill his sisters. The man who has been in control of Michael's mind is the one who wakes him up from his one-year coma. AND Michael and the man share the same tatoo opn eachother's wrists...a symbol of the druids. The man wanted to save Michael because of the fact that his sprits are not really living unless Mike is on his crazy killing sprees. The two kidnap the niece, and she has to live in a secret catacombs with them for years...the rest are spoilers...and are revealed in Part 6. |
